Is it very likely that rhinitis will turn into nasopharyngeal cancer? What are the symptoms of nasopharyngeal cancer?

1. Nasal cancer or paranasal sinus cancer usually refers to malignant tumors of the nose or paranasal sinuses. The most common ones are nasal malignant lymphoma, nasopharyngeal carcinoma and other tumors. Its etiology is mainly related to genetics, viral infection and environmental factors. There is no clear evidence that chronic rhinitis and chronic sinusitis and paranasal sinusitis can cause nasal malignancies.

2. However, the main symptoms of sinusitis are nasal congestion, pus and headache. Sinus cancer or malignant tumors may also have similar symptoms. Sinus cancer may also be accompanied by sinusitis.

3. Symptoms of sinus malignancy are progressive and worsening. There are no symptoms in the early stage, but in the late stage, nasal congestion and bloody runny nose may occur. Facial numbness and swelling, eye displacement, loose teeth, decreased vision, difficulty opening the mouth or other neurological symptoms may occur.

Doctors may find sinus bone damage after CT and X-ray examinations, and pathological examination can make a diagnosis. Sinusitis usually occurs after a cold, with a history of multiple attacks, no blood, and pus is mostly sticky. Antibiotic treatment is effective, but anti-inflammatory treatment of sinus malignant tumors is ineffective.

Symptoms of nasopharyngeal cancer may include:

1. Runny nose and blood in sputum: especially the first sputum in the morning that contains blood.

2. Stuffy ears, blocked ears, and hearing loss, especially on one side of the ear.

3. Neck lumps: especially hard, fixed lumps under the ears on the neck.

4. Headache: often stubborn and difficult to relieve with medication.

5. Double vision, esotropia, cross-eyes, etc.
